Features of Lockscreen Japanese Word Alarm:
- Dual Brain Learning
The app engages both the left and right brain to learn Japanese vocabulary effectively, creating a holistic approach to language acquisition. By stimulating both hemispheres, you can enhance your memory and understanding of the language.
- Convenient Lockscreen Memorization
Words are displayed on the lockscreen for easy access to learning every time you turn on your phone, making it effortless to practice throughout the day. This method ensures that you're constantly exposed to new vocabulary, reinforcing your learning without additional effort.
- Personalized Learning Experience
Choose the level of vocabulary that matches your proficiency, create personalized vocabulary lists, and hide memorized words to tailor your learning journey. This customization ensures that you're always challenged at the right level, making your learning experience more effective and enjoyable.
- Interactive Quiz Alarms
Receive quiz alarms at your preferred times to test your knowledge and review learning statistics to track your progress. These quizzes help reinforce what you've learned and keep you motivated by showing your improvement over time.
FAQs:
- Can I use the app without an internet connection?
Yes, you can use the app offline, making it convenient for learning on the go. This feature ensures that you can continue your language learning journey even when you're not connected to the internet.
- How often should I take quizzes?
You can set quiz alarms based on your preferred schedule, whether it's daily, weekly, or at specific times during the day. This flexibility allows you to integrate learning into your routine in a way that suits your lifestyle.
- Are the example sentences provided relevant for everyday use?
Yes, the example sentences are written by native Japanese speakers and are useful for real-life situations to enhance your language skills. These sentences provide context and practical usage, making your learning more applicable to everyday conversations.
